Analysis

The most recent figure for share of children, working-age adults, and older people in Pakistan is 91.67 million people, measured in 2023. That is the highest value across all 74 years on record.

That represents a change of up 0.8% on the previous year and up 11.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, share of children, working-age adults, and older people in Pakistan peaked at 91.67 million people in 2023 and was at its lowest, 15.35 million people, in 1950.

That places Pakistan 4th out of 236 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the top 10%.
